Bonjour,
Je sais comment créer un cube OLAP en utilisant l'assistant sur SAS OLAP studio mais mon souci c'est que je sais pas est ce que c'est un ROLAP, MOLAP ou HOLAP
merci d'avance
Bonjour,
Je sais comment créer un cube OLAP en utilisant l'assistant sur SAS OLAP studio mais mon souci c'est que je sais pas est ce que c'est un ROLAP, MOLAP ou HOLAP
merci d'avance
fait MOLAP au debut : toutes les infos seront dans le cube
Merci pour ta réponse
mais comment paramétrer ça au niveau de l'assistant sas olap studio. est ce qu'il y a des cases à cocher pour montrer que tu veux créer un ROLAP ou MOLAP?
SAlut dehasmae,
Pour répondre à ta question faisons un peu d'historique,SAS offre la possibilité de créer trois types de cubes,
- MOLAP: Le cube est crée avec toutes ses aggrégations qui sont stockées dans une structure physique (Schéma OLAP) et accessible par l'intermédiaire de SAS OLAP CUBE Server.
- ROLAP: Cube relationnel ou aucune agrégation n'est définies et qui est basé sur la structure relationnelle des tables du SGBD.
- HOLAP:Qui est un mix des deux précédent.
Tu peux jeter un coup d'oeil à cet article :Using SAS OLAP Server for a ROLAP Scenario ou encore celui-ci ROLAP and HOLAP solutions using SAS and Teradata..
Généralement, pour construire un cube HOLAP, on crée un cube ROLAP et on ajoute des agrégations. Si on ajoute toutes les agrégations possibles, on obtient un cube MOLAP.
Alors comment faire pour créér un cube ROLAP, il suffit lors de l'avant dernière étape (désolé si je me trompes), de cocher la case don't create an NWAY aggregation . Sous SAS 9.2 en effectuant un clic droit sur son cube, puis Mise au point d’agrégation, àtravers les 3 onglets (analyse du fichier de journal AMR, Cardinalité, La mise au point manuelle) de définir un cube HOLAP et MOLAP.
Pour la création dun cube HOALP, à l'onglet cardinalité, tu cliques sur Analyser et tu pouras choisir les aggrégations à rajouter dans ton cube (Tu peux également l'effectuer en utilisant la procédure PROC OLAP qui par la suite sera exécuter par la Workspace Server).
Merci beaucoup pour ta réponse je vais tester ça quand je serai au boulot
Vous avez un bloqueur de publicités installé.
Le Club Developpez.com n'affiche que des publicités IT, discrètes et non intrusives.
Afin que nous puissions continuer à vous fournir gratuitement du contenu de qualité, merci de nous soutenir en désactivant votre bloqueur de publicités sur Developpez.com.
Partager